It might sound obvious, but this question often gets overlooked during the excitement of negotiations. Buyers usually rely on general home inspections — which is a great start — but pest inspections are a different story altogether.
Mississauga’s seasonal changes make it a comfortable environment for pests such as carpenter ants, rodents, spiders, and even termites. These invaders don’t just create nuisance — they can quietly damage wiring, contaminate surfaces, and weaken building structures long before you notice any signs.
Before you proceed with a purchase, ask the seller for detailed pest control history or schedule a pest inspection of your own. Professionals can identify hidden infestations in attic insulation, crawl spaces, or even walls. A small investment upfront could spare you from serious costs later, especially if you’re dealing with termite or rodent damage.
Mississauga has a mix of older homes with vintage charm and newer builds with modern finishes. While both have their appeal, age plays a big role in determining how much maintenance a property may require.
Older houses may have moisture issues, cracked foundations, or worn sealing — all common entry points for pests. A weak roof or damaged attic can invite wildlife like squirrels and raccoons seeking warmth during cooler months. Even newly built homes aren’t immune; construction gaps sometimes allow ants or rodents easy access before sealing work is complete.
Ask about the roof’s replacement date, check attic ventilation, and look for gaps around vents and eaves. Remember, in a city with cold winters and humid summers like Mississauga, preventive maintenance is your best defense against long term problems.
A home doesn’t exist in isolation — its surroundings can attract unwanted visitors. Trees too close to the structure, unmaintained gardens, open garbage spots, or nearby water sources may all contribute to pest activity.
If the house you’re eyeing sits near a ravine, wooded area, or parkland (Mississauga has plenty of them), inspect carefully for wildlife pathways. You’ll need to ensure the property is well sealed and that outdoor areas are pest resistant.
A pest professional can help identify environmental factors that make a property prone to infestations. They can also recommend prevention tips, such as proper waste management, blocking entry points, or installing deterrents. A bit of due diligence before buying ensures your future backyard stays peaceful and pest free.
Another key but often forgotten question: ask the seller or listing agent about the home’s pest control record. Was professional pest management ever performed? What types of treatment were used, and when was the last service done?
Regular preventive maintenance signals that the property was cared for — and likely in good shape. On the other hand, the absence of pest records should raise a red flag, especially in older or multi unit dwellings.
